ProcessingThere are many ways to process the Noni fruit for human consumptions. The most popular but not the most effective is Noni juice. The other methods include Puree, Tablets, Capsules, and Powder. JuiceNoni juice should be made from ripe fruit. The fruit is either squeezed or placed on screens and allowed to drip into vats. The resulting juice is then filtered to insure that there are not particles in the resulting product. Noni products that are labeled 100% do not have any flavoring agents, sweeteners, or thickeners. Not all Noni juice is a 100% Noni and many that are listed as a 100% still have water added to them. If the Noni juice is 100% without water added then it will have a concentration of 1 to 1. 100% Noni juice also has a very strong taste. PureeNoni puree is made from the entire Noni fruit. The fruit is mashed finely into a thick liquid puree. Often vendors will add other juices to this product for both thinning and flavoring purposes. This product often has a concentration of less than 1 to 1. As with Noni Juice it is imperative to insure that they have been pasteurized. Un-pasteurized juice and puree products may contain harmful bacteria. TabletsCreating tablets begins by drying the Noni fruit, and then irradiating it to clean and sanitize the dried fruit. After the Noni has undergone this process the dried fruit is ground into a fine powder that is then pressed into molds then baked to complete the process. The number of times that the Noni fruit is extruded determines the concentration when the tablet is baked. Also the baking process of the Noni fruit may cause it to loose some of its nutritional properties. Tablets typically have a 5 to 1 concentration ratio. CapsulesCapsules are made using a similar process as tablets with the exception of the baking. The Noni is dried, extruded to reach the desired concentration and then encapsulated in a soluble shell usually made of rice. Capsules typically have a 5 to 1 concentration. PowderNoni powder under goes the same process as both tablets and capsules except it is neither baked or encapsulated. Many vendors then add the powder to a juice. Noni powder typically has a 5 to 1 concentration before adding it to juice which further diminishes the concentration. |
